How does Auburn, WA compare to Redmond, WA? Auburn has a population of 85,455 with a median household income of $95,367, while Redmond has 75,721 residents and a median income of $162,099.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
| Metric | Auburn, WA | Redmond, WA |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 85,455 | 75,721 | +12.9% |
| Median Age | 35.7 | 35 | +2.0% |
| Foreign Born % | 23.4% | 44.4% | -47.3% |
| Metric | Auburn | Redmond |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Income | $95,367 | $162,099 | -41.2% |
| Unemployment | 5.3% | 4.1% | +29.3% |
| Poverty Rate | 7.6% | 5.8% | +31.0% |
| Bachelor's+ | 27% | 74.7% | -63.9% |
| Metric | Auburn | Redmond |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Home Value | $510,400 | $1,091,700 | -53.2% |
| Median Rent | $1713/mo | $2343/mo | -26.9% |
| Housing Units | 32,096 | 33,884 | -5.3% |
